Meta announced the launch of a new Meta AI app, built with Llama 4, marking a step towards creating a more personal AI experience. Users globally are familiar with Meta AI through platforms like WhatsApp, Instagram, Facebook, and Messenger. Now, they have the option to use a standalone app designed for voice interaction with Meta AI.
According to Meta, “Meta AI is built to get to know you, so its answers are more helpful.” The app aims to make interactions more seamless and natural by being easy to talk to and more social. It also allows users to utilize voice features while multitasking on their devices, with an icon indicating when the microphone is in use.
The app's Llama 4 model provides responses that are more personal and relevant. It integrates with other Meta AI features such as image generation and editing, enabling these functions through voice or text conversations with the AI assistant.
Additionally, a voice demo with full-duplex technology is included. “This technology will deliver a more natural voice experience trained on conversational dialogue, so the AI is generating voice directly instead of reading written responses.” However, this feature is not connected to real-time information on the web. While technical issues may arise, Meta plans to improve the experience based on user feedback.
Initially, voice conversations and the full duplex demo are available in the U.S., Canada, Australia, and New Zealand. Meta encourages individuals to visit their help center for more information on managing their experience on the app.
Meta AI is designed to assist users with problem-solving, daily inquiries, and understanding their surroundings. It can conduct web searches, offer recommendations, and maintain connectivity with friends and family. For casual interactions, the app provides conversation starters.
Meta emphasizes that the AI assistant can remember user preferences, such as a love for travel or language learning, to offer more personalized responses. This personalization is enhanced by information shared on Meta platforms, with added benefits for users who link their Facebook and Instagram accounts.
The newly launched Meta AI app features a Discover feed, allowing users to explore and share AI usage prompts. User control over shared content remains a priority.
Meta AI is incorporated across all platforms and devices, including integration with Ray-Ban Meta glasses. This combination allows for continuity in AI experiences, such as starting conversations on the glasses and continuing them on the app.
The Meta AI web platform is also receiving feature upgrades, including voice interactions and a Discover feed. Enhancements include an optimized interface for desktops and improved image generation elements. In select regions, a document editor for creating and exporting documents as PDFs is under testing. Meta is also evaluating a feature to import documents for AI analysis.
Meta highlights the intuitive nature of voice interaction with AI and has made voice the center of the Meta AI app experience, allowing users to start conversations at the press of a button. The app is available on iOS and Android.
